.button,.gilaki,label{cursor:pointer;font-size:12px}.select2-container{width:100%}.select2-container a.select2-choice{height:40px;padding-left:15px;color:#696969;background-image:none;background-color:#f5f5f5;border:1px solid #f0f0f0;border-radius:3px}.select2-container-active a.select2-choice{border-radius:3px 3px 0 0;box-shadow:none}.select2-container a.select2-choice>span.select2-chosen{margin-top:5px}.select2-container a.select2-choice>abbr.select2-search-choice-close{position:absolute;top:11px;right:40px}.select2-container a.select2-choice>abbr.select2-search-choice-close:before{display:block;content:"\f00d";color:#979797;font-size:16px;font-family:Awesome;line-height:16px;transition:all .2s ease-out;-moz-transition:all .2s ease-out;-webkit-transition:all .2s ease-out;-o-transition:all .2s ease-out;-ms-transition:all .2s ease-out}.select2-container a.select2-choice>abbr.select2-search-choice-close:hover:before{color:#333}.select2-container .select2-choice .select2-arrow{width:30px;background:0 0;border:none;border-radius:0}.select2-container .select2-choice .select2-arrow b:before{display:block;content:"\f107";color:#979797;font-size:24px;font-family:Awesome;line-height:37px}.select2-dropdown-open .select2-choice .select2-arrow b:before{content:"\f106"}.select2-drop{padding-top:5px;box-shadow:none}.select2-drop-active{border-color:#e5e5e5}.select2-search input{border-color:#ddd}.button,.gilaki{display:inline-block;height:40px;padding:0 15px;color:#fff;font-family:NotoPenekeko;background-color:#999;border-radius:3px;line-height:38px}.button:hover,.gilaki:hover{background-color:#777}.button button{position:absolute;opacity:0;left:0;top:0;width:100%;height:100%;cursor:pointer}.checker{float:left;width:20px;height:20px;margin-top:10px;margin-bottom:10px;background-color:#efefef;border:1px solid #e5e5e5;border-radius:3px}.checker span input,.checker span:before{width:100%;height:100%;left:0;top:0;position:absolute}.checker:hover{border:1px solid #ccc}.checker span:before{display:block;color:#999;font-size:12px;font-family:Awesome;text-align:center;content:"\f00c";opacity:0;transition:all .2s ease-out;-moz-transition:all .2s ease-out;-webkit-transition:all .2s ease-out;-o-transition:all .2s ease-out;-ms-transition:all .2s ease-out}.checker span.checked:before{opacity:1}.checker span input,.radio span input{margin:0 !important;opacity:0}.checker span.checked{background-color:#999}.radio{float:left;width:20px;height:20px;background-color:#efefef;border-radius:50%}.radio span,.radio span:before{width:100%;height:100%;border-radius:50%}.radio span{position:relative;display:flex;display:-webkit-box;display:-ms-flexbox;display:-webkit-flex;align-items:center;justify-content:center}.radio span:before{display:block;content:"";transform:scale(0);transition:all .2s ease;-moz-transition:all .2s ease;-webkit-transition:all .2s ease;-o-transition:all .2s ease;-ms-transition:all .2s ease}.radio span.checked:before{background-color:#999;transform:scale(.5)}.radio span input{position:absolute;width:20px;height:20px;left:0;top:0}input,textarea{width:100%;background-color:#f9f9f9}input{border:1px solid #f0f0f0;border-radius:3px}textarea{height:210px;padding:15px;border:1px solid #f0f0f0;border-radius:3px}label{color:#696969;font-family:NotoPenekeko;font-weight:400;line-height:1.43}